Five new levels, four new enemy types, and a new boss. I think it also adds some new maps for "survival mode".

Anyone who likes pure shooters and hasn't played Hard Reset yet needs to get it. It's 75% off right now ($3.75) during Steam's summer sale.

I wanted to like it. The cyberpunk atmosphere simply blew me away and I was so pumped up by the intro that I had to send a youtube video with the introduction to a friend who like the same genré. Then the game begun and I couldn't handle more than a few minutes. Amazing atmosphere, but completely wrong game for me. The only First-Person Shooter like that I have been able to handle and enjoy was Serious Sam and that is because Serious Sam is a satire of regular first-person shooters that make me laugh, at the same time I hated Painkiller. That said, Hard Reset presents an amazing scenery that just reeks of stuff I would like to interact with, if it was actually inhabited by people. But it isn't, you just shoot robots.
